Understanding Curly Hair

Curly hair has a distinct structure that often makes it more prone to dryness and frizz. The natural oils produced by the scalp have a harder time traveling down the hair shaft, leaving the strands more vulnerable. That’s why selecting the right hair products is crucial to keep your curls looking their best.

Essential Hair Care Products for Curly Hair

best hair products for curly hair

When it comes to caring for your curly hair, having the right products in your arsenal can make all the difference. Curly hair requires extra attention and hydration to maintain its health and vibrancy. Here are some essential hair care products that every curly-haired man should consider incorporating into his routine:

1. Shampoo and Conditioner

A good foundation for any hair care routine starts with a suitable shampoo and conditioner. For curly hair, opt for sulfate-free formulas that gently cleanse without stripping away natural oils. Look for products labeled specifically for curly or wavy hair, as they are formulated to provide the necessary moisture and support for your unique hair type.

2. Leave-In Conditioner

Leave-in conditioners are a game-changer for curly hair. These lightweight, hydrating products can be applied to damp hair and left in without rinsing. They provide continuous moisture throughout the day, helping to combat frizz and maintain your curls’ natural bounce. Simply work a small amount through your hair, focusing on the mid-lengths to ends.

3. Curl-Enhancing Cream

Curl-enhancing creams are designed to define and shape your curls while taming frizz. These products often contain ingredients that help your curls clump together, creating more defined and manageable strands. Apply the cream evenly through your hair, scrunching gently to encourage curl formation. This step can be crucial in achieving that coveted well-defined curl pattern.

4. Styling Gel or Mousse

Styling gels or mousses can help set your curls in place and provide additional hold. Choose a product with a light to medium hold to avoid weighing down your curls. Apply the gel or mousse evenly through your damp hair, scrunching as you go. You can either air-dry or use a diffuser to speed up the drying process while enhancing volume and definition.

5. Microfiber Towel or T-shirt

Drying your curly hair with a traditional towel can lead to frizz and disrupt your curl pattern. Instead, opt for a microfiber towel or a soft cotton T-shirt to gently blot excess moisture from your hair. Avoid rubbing or twisting, as this can cause hair breakage and frizz. Patting your hair gently will help maintain your curls’ shape and integrity.

6. Wide-Tooth Comb or Detangling Brush

Curly hair is more prone to tangles, so having a wide-tooth comb or detangling brush is essential. Start detangling from the ends and work your way up to the roots, being gentle to avoid unnecessary breakage. A comb or brush designed for wet hair can help distribute products evenly and prevent further damage while detangling.

7. Heat Protectant

If you occasionally use heat styling tools, such as a diffuser or a hairdryer with a diffuser attachment, using a heat protectant is crucial. Heat protectants create a barrier between your hair and the heat, minimizing damage and maintaining the integrity of your curls.

Remember, the key to successful curly hair care is finding the right products that work for your unique hair type. Experiment with different brands and formulations to discover the perfect combination that enhances your curls’ natural beauty while keeping them healthy and manageable.

Natural Remedies for Curly Hair

While commercial hair care products play a vital role in maintaining your curly hair’s health and appearance, sometimes nature’s own remedies can work wonders too. Natural ingredients often provide deep nourishment and hydration, helping your curls shine and thrive. Here are a couple of natural remedies that you can incorporate into your curly hair care routine:

1. Coconut Oil

Coconut oil is a versatile and widely celebrated natural remedy for curly hair. Rich in fatty acids, coconut oil has the ability to penetrate the hair shaft, providing deep hydration and reducing frizz. To use coconut oil, warm a small amount between your palms and distribute it evenly through your damp or dry hair. Leave it on for a few hours or even overnight before washing it out. This treatment can help restore moisture, improve hair elasticity, and enhance your curls’ natural texture.

2. Aloe Vera

Aloe vera is another natural ingredient that can work wonders for curly hair. Its hydrating and soothing properties make it an excellent choice for taming frizz, adding shine, and promoting overall hair health. You can use aloe vera gel directly from the plant’s leaves or opt for commercially available pure aloe vera gel. Apply a small amount to your hair, focusing on the ends and any areas prone to frizz. Aloe vera can also help calm an itchy scalp, making it a valuable addition to your natural curly hair care routine.

Remember, the effectiveness of natural remedies can vary from person to person, so it’s important to experiment and observe how your hair responds. As with any new product or treatment, it’s recommended to do a patch test first to ensure you don’t have any adverse reactions.

Incorporating these natural remedies alongside your regular hair care routine can provide an extra boost of hydration and nourishment, helping you maintain those gorgeous, healthy curls.

Dos and Don'ts for Curly Hair Care

Caring for curly hair requires a tailored approach to ensure your locks remain healthy, vibrant, and full of life. By following a few key dos and avoiding some common pitfalls, you can maintain the integrity of your curls and achieve the look you desire. Here are some essential dos and don’ts for curly hair care:

Dos:

  1. Embrace the Curly Lifestyle: Embrace your natural curls and work with their unique texture. Instead of constantly straightening or fighting against your curls, learn to enhance and style them to your advantage.

  2. Choose the Right Products: Opt for hair care products specifically formulated for curly hair. Look for sulfate-free shampoos, hydrating conditioners, and curl-enhancing creams that provide the necessary moisture and support your curls need.

  3. Hydrate Regularly: Curly hair tends to be drier due to its structure, so make hydration a priority. Use leave-in conditioners, deep conditioning treatments, and natural oils to provide your curls with the moisture they crave.

  4. Detangle Gently: Use a wide-tooth comb or detangling brush to gently remove knots and tangles. Start from the tips and work your way up to avoid unnecessary breakage.

  5. Air-Dry Whenever Possible: Letting your hair air-dry reduces exposure to heat and minimizes frizz. After applying your products, allow your curls to dry naturally or use a diffuser attachment on your hairdryer for a gentle airflow.

Don'ts:

  1. Avoid Heat Styling Excessively: Excessive heat styling can lead to damage and disrupt your curl pattern. Minimize the use of flat irons, curling wands, and blow dryers on high heat settings.

  2. Say No to Sulfates: Sulfates found in some shampoos can strip your hair of natural oils, causing it to become dry and frizzy. Opt for sulfate-free shampoos to maintain moisture levels in your curly hair.

  3. Avoid Overwashing: Washing your hair too frequently can strip away essential oils that keep your curls hydrated. Aim to wash your hair 2-3 times a week to maintain its natural oils.

  4. Don’t Rub Your Hair with a Towel: Rubbing your hair vigorously with a towel can cause friction, leading to frizz and breakage. Instead, gently blot your hair with a microfiber towel or soft T-shirt to absorb excess water.

  5. Avoid Tight Hairstyles: Pulling your hair back into tight ponytails or buns can lead to stress on your curls, causing them to lose their shape and bounce. Opt for loose, gentle hairstyles to prevent damage.

By following these dos and avoiding these don’ts, you can establish a healthy curly hair care routine that enhances your natural beauty and promotes the long-term health of your curls. Remember, every curl is unique, so take the time to understand what works best for your hair type and texture.

Styling Tips for Curly Hair

Styling curly hair can be a creative and enjoyable process, allowing you to showcase your unique texture and personality. Whether you’re aiming for defined curls or a carefree, messy look, there are various techniques you can use to achieve your desired style. Here are some styling tips to help you make the most of your curly locks:

1. Defined Curls with Finger Coiling

Finger coiling is a technique that can help you achieve well-defined and uniform curls. To finger coil, take small sections of damp hair and wrap them around your finger from root to tip. Gently slide your finger out, allowing the curl to set. Repeat this process throughout your hair, focusing on areas where you want more definition. Once your hair is dry, you can gently separate the coils to create fuller curls.

2. Messy Curls with Sea Salt Spray

If you’re aiming for a relaxed and beachy look, sea salt spray can be your secret weapon. Apply sea salt spray to damp hair and scrunch your curls to encourage them to form naturally. This technique enhances texture and provides a tousled appearance, perfect for a casual and carefree style. Avoid overusing sea salt spray, as it can lead to dryness over time.

3. Pineapple Updo for Overnight Volume

To maintain volume and prevent flat curls while you sleep, try the “pineapple” method. Gather your curls into a loose, high ponytail at the top of your head, securing it with a soft scrunchie. This technique prevents friction between your curls and the pillow, preserving their shape and bounce. In the morning, release the ponytail, gently shake your hair out, and fluff your curls with your fingers.

4. Twist-Outs for Soft Waves

A twist-out is a popular styling method that creates soft waves and adds volume to your curls. Start with damp hair and divide it into sections. Take each section and twist it from root to tip, then secure the end with a small hair tie or clip. Allow your hair to air-dry or use a diffuser on low heat. Once your hair is dry, carefully unravel the twists to reveal beautiful waves.

5. Plopping for Frizz Control

Plopping is a technique that helps control frizz and maintain curl definition while your hair dries. After applying your styling products, place a cotton T-shirt or microfiber towel on a flat surface. Flip your hair onto the towel, gather the sides of the towel around your head, and secure it. Leave your hair “plopped” for about 20-30 minutes before releasing it. This method encourages your curls to set in their natural pattern while minimizing friction and frizz.

Experiment with these styling tips to discover what works best for your hair type and desired look. Remember, embracing your curls’ natural texture and characteristics is key to achieving stunning results. Whether you’re aiming for defined curls or a relaxed vibe, these techniques can help you create beautiful styles that showcase the beauty of your curly hair.

Maintaining Healthy Scalp and Hair

A healthy scalp is the foundation for strong and vibrant curly hair. Taking care of your scalp not only promotes hair growth but also ensures that your curls remain lustrous and manageable. Follow these tips to maintain a healthy scalp and keep your curly hair in its best condition:

1. Regular Trimming

Regular haircuts are essential for maintaining the health of your curls. Trimming your hair every 6-8 weeks helps prevent split ends from traveling up the hair shaft, preserving the integrity of your curls. A well-maintained cut also ensures that your curls fall naturally and appear more defined.

2. Scalp Massages

Massaging your scalp regularly can improve blood circulation to the hair follicles, promoting healthy hair growth. Use your fingertips to gently massage your scalp in circular motions while shampooing or applying conditioner. This practice not only feels relaxing but also helps distribute natural oils and nutrients to the hair shaft.

3. Choose Scalp-Friendly Products

When selecting hair care products, consider those that are gentle on your scalp. Avoid products containing harsh sulfates and opt for formulas that are sulfate-free and enriched with natural ingredients. A healthy scalp contributes to the overall health of your curls, so investing in scalp-friendly products is important.

4. Maintain a Balanced Diet

Your hair’s health is influenced by your overall well-being. Consuming a balanced diet rich in vitamins, minerals, and proteins can support healthy hair growth. Include foods that are high in biotin, vitamin E, and omega-3 fatty acids, as they are known to contribute to strong and shiny hair.

5. Protect Your Hair at Night

Consider using a satin or silk pillowcase to protect your hair while you sleep. These materials create less friction than cotton, reducing the risk of frizz and breakage. Additionally, wrapping your hair in a satin scarf or bonnet can help preserve your curls’ shape and prevent tangles.

6. Avoid Overwashing

While keeping your scalp clean is important, overwashing can strip away natural oils that keep your curls hydrated. Aim to wash your hair 2-3 times a week, using a sulfate-free shampoo. If you need to refresh your curls between washes, consider using a co-wash or a light leave-in conditioner.

7. Stay Hydrated

Proper hydration is crucial for healthy hair and scalp. Drinking enough water throughout the day helps maintain the moisture balance in your scalp, promoting optimal hair growth and preventing dryness.

By paying attention to your scalp’s health and adopting these practices, you can ensure that your curly hair remains strong, shiny, and full of life. A healthy scalp provides the perfect environment for your curls to thrive, and the results will be evident in the beauty and vibrancy of your hair.

Common Curly Hair Problems and Solutions

While curly hair is undeniably beautiful, it also comes with its own set of challenges. From frizz to dryness, understanding and addressing these common issues is key to maintaining the health and appearance of your curls. Here are some frequent curly hair problems and effective solutions:

1. Frizz Control

Problem: Frizz is a common concern for curly-haired individuals, especially in humid conditions. It can make your curls appear unruly and undefined.

Solution: To combat frizz, use products that provide hydration and hold, such as leave-in conditioners and curl-enhancing creams. Apply these products when your hair is damp to lock in moisture. Additionally, avoid touching your hair excessively throughout the day, as it can contribute to frizz.

2. Dryness and Hydration

Problem: Curly hair tends to be drier due to its structure, making it more prone to dryness, dullness, and brittleness.

Solution: Hydration is key. Use a deep conditioning treatment once a week to provide your hair with much-needed moisture. Consider incorporating natural oils, such as coconut oil or argan oil, into your routine. These oils can help lock in moisture and promote healthy, shiny curls.

3. Lack of Definition

Problem: Sometimes, curls can lose their definition and become flat or limp, causing them to blend together.

Solution: Enhance curl definition by using curl-enhancing products and techniques. Apply curl-defining creams or gels to damp hair and encourage your curls to form by scrunching them gently. You can also experiment with different styling methods, like finger coiling or twist-outs, to achieve well-defined curls.

4. Knots and Tangles

Problem: Curly hair is more prone to tangling and knots due to its texture and shape.

Solution: Regularly detangle your hair using a wide-tooth comb or a detangling brush. Start from the ends and work your way up, being gentle to prevent breakage. Applying a leave-in conditioner can also help make the detangling process smoother.

5. Shrinkage

Problem: Shrinkage occurs when curly hair appears shorter than its actual length when dry, giving the illusion of less length.

Solution: Embrace shrinkage as a natural characteristic of curly hair. To showcase your hair’s true length, consider stretching your curls using techniques like twist-outs or braid-outs. You can also use heatless stretching methods, like banding or threading, to achieve more visible length.

6. Product Buildup

Problem: Using too many products without proper cleansing can lead to product buildup, causing dullness and weighed-down curls.

Solution: Use a clarifying shampoo occasionally to remove buildup and give your hair a fresh start. Consider following up with a deep conditioning treatment to restore moisture after clarifying.

By understanding these common curly hair problems and applying the appropriate solutions, you can overcome challenges and embrace the beauty of your natural curls. Tailoring your routine to address your hair’s specific needs will lead to healthier, more manageable, and more stunning curls.

The Curly Hair Routine: Step by Step

Establishing a consistent curly hair routine is essential for maintaining the health, definition, and beauty of your curls. By following a step-by-step approach tailored to your hair’s needs, you can achieve the best results for your unique curl pattern. Here’s a comprehensive guide to help you navigate your curly hair care routine:

1. Cleansing and Conditioning

Start by wetting your hair thoroughly with lukewarm water. Apply a sulfate-free shampoo to your scalp, massaging gently to cleanse away dirt and excess oil. Avoid vigorously scrubbing your hair, as this can lead to tangling and frizz. Rinse the shampoo thoroughly.

Follow up with a hydrating conditioner. Apply the conditioner from mid-lengths to ends, focusing on areas prone to dryness. Use a wide-tooth comb or your fingers to detangle your hair while the conditioner is in. Leave the conditioner on for a few minutes before rinsing with cool water to seal the cuticles and enhance shine.

2. Applying Leave-In Conditioner

While your hair is still damp, apply a leave-in conditioner to provide ongoing moisture and control. Begin with a small amount and distribute it evenly through your hair, using your fingers or a wide-tooth comb. This step helps prevent frizz and ensures your curls remain hydrated as they dry.

3. Enhancing with Curl Cream

Next, apply a curl-enhancing cream to define and shape your curls. Take a small amount of the cream and work it through your hair, focusing on the mid-lengths to ends. Scrunch your curls gently to encourage curl formation and help the product distribute evenly. This step enhances your curls’ natural pattern and reduces frizz.

4. Styling and Setting

If desired, apply a lightweight styling gel or mousse to set your curls and provide extra hold. Use a dime-sized amount and distribute it evenly through your hair, scrunching as you go. This step helps lock in the curl pattern and ensures your style lasts throughout the day.

5. Drying Techniques

Allow your hair to air-dry whenever possible to minimize heat damage and reduce frizz. To speed up the drying process, consider using a diffuser attachment on your hairdryer. Set the dryer to a low heat and airflow setting and gently cup your curls with the diffuser, lifting them at the roots. Avoid touching your hair too much while it’s drying to prevent disrupting the curl formation.

6. Final Touches

Once your hair is completely dry, gently scrunch your curls to break the gel cast and achieve a soft, natural finish. If needed, you can further define individual curls by twirling them around your finger or using a small amount of curl-enhancing cream.

Remember, your curly hair routine may require some trial and error to find the perfect products and techniques for your specific curl pattern. Consistency is key, so aim to follow this routine regularly to maintain healthy, well-defined curls. With time and practice, you’ll master the art of caring for your curly hair and showcasing its natural beauty.
